Assn. serves ultimatum to DC

ITANAGAR, Jun 27: The All Ziro Hapoli Youth Association (AZHYA) has served a 15-day ultimatum starting June 25, to the Lower Subansiri deputy commissioner for early fulfilment of its three-point demands which includes; immediate dismantling of illegal structure over the public footpath adjacent to Hapoli power house besides, erection of police beat post at medical colony and school gate at Hapoli and proper street electrification of Ziro and Hapoli town for public safety.
Claiming that no action was initiated by the office of the deputy commissioner regarding the aforementioned matters despite its repeated submission of complaint letters, the association said that it will be compelled to resort to democratic action in case its demands are not met within stipulated time.
